How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Georgetown?
| Bedroom | Average Price | Cheapest Price | Highest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Georgetown Studio Apartments | $2,089 | $1,483 | $2,682 |
| Georgetown 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,844 | $1,621 | $3,558 |
| Georgetown 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,339 | $1,951 | $4,604 |
| Georgetown 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,476 | $2,800 | $5,600 |
| Georgetown 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,000 | $5,000 | $5,000 |
